- Description:
- Contents include but are not limited to Mississippi 4-H club girl wins national radio essay contest, Black American actors stranded in Russia after film project canceled, Washington police terrorize Black residents following white officer's death, Iowa Bystander plans special edition for annual Buxton camp reunion, NAACP urges Black voters to oppose pro-Parker Senate candidates, and other topics.
